WebFor example, the factor for climate change is 8.1∙10 3 kg CO 2 eq./person. Weighting Weighting supports the interpretation and communication of the results of the analysis. In this step, normalised results are multiplied by a set of weighting factors (in %) which reflect the perceived relative importance of the life cycle impact categories ... Web22. jul 2013. · Land use is one of the main drivers of biodiversity loss. However, many life cycle assessment studies do not yet assess this effect because of the lack of reliable and operational methods. Here, we present an approach to modeling the impacts of regional land use on plants, mammals, birds, amphibians, and reptiles. WebIn summary, the weight of a manatee varies depending on factors such as age, gender, and species. Adult manatees typically measure 9 to 10 feet in length and weigh around 1,000 pounds. However, some manatees can grow larger, reaching up to 13 feet in length and weighing more than 3,500 pounds. Female manatees tend to be larger and heavier than ...
